Provenance notes for the Pellgrove template renderer. Support folks: if a customer reports slow page renders, first check which renderer build they're on — the Ashfern 3.x line has the cached-partial fix, older ones don't. Build provenance is attested at publish time, so you can trust the reported version string. The latest attested perf-fix build carries the token below.

session token of bawep-yadup = htk21_528abd376e3c5a4ec24a1

## TICKET: Expired credentials — dispatch heuristic blocked

The Roukesport driver-assignment heuristic stopped scoring candidates overnight. Root cause: the service credential for the Halden distance-matrix API expired, so every assignment falls back to naive nearest-driver, inflating ETAs ~18%. New folks: the heuristic lives in `dispatch-brain` and calls Halden on every batch; without auth it silently degrades rather than failing. Rotation is done — redeploy `dispatch-brain` with the fresh internal key shown below.

service key, yadug-bajog: zpat3_pou

Hi, and welcome to the Strandmap on-call rotation. Strandmap is our dependency graph visualizer; support tickets usually involve stale graphs or missing edges after a repo rename. Most issues resolve with a re-index, which you can trigger from the admin panel. Rendering timeouts on graphs over 10k nodes are a known limit. Triage steps, common errors, and escalation criteria are collected on the internal page here.

wiki page, tahaf-tajog: https://jira.ordindyn.corp/pipeline